cpv2.jpgYou probably know how you can use a magnifying glass to concentrate solar power into a small spot and start a fire. The solar power researchers at IBM have taken it a step further and managed to concentrate incoming solar energy by a factor of 2300, equaling about 230 watts of power on a square centimeter. This energy could then be converted into about 70 watts of usable electric energy. The biggest problem with concentrating the suns rays this much is that it heats the solar cells to about 1600 degrees Celsius, which would melt them. IBM however is an expert at cooling high power computer chips and managed to keep the solar cells at a ‘cool’ 85 degrees Celsius!
